Miralax, a well-known over-the-counter laxative, is primarily composed of polyethylene glycol 3350. It works by drawing water into the stool and promoting regular bowel movements, making it a go-to solution for those dealing with constipation or preparing for medical procedures like colonoscopies. On the other hand, Gatorade is a popular sports drink packed with electrolytes, designed to replenish fluids and nutrients lost during exercise. When mixed together, these two components can create an effective yet easy-to-consume mixture that aids in hydration while prompting proper digestion, particularly in clinical settings. This blend can be beneficial for individuals who need a gentle and effective way to stay hydrated and maintain digestive health.

Potential Side Effects
While Miralax and Gatorade are generally safe when taken as directed, it’s vital to be aware of potential side effects. Some individuals might experience mild stomach cramping, bloating, or diarrhea. If these symptoms become severe or persistent, it’s crucial to seek medical advice. Additionally, if you’re on other medications or have underlying health conditions, discussing the use of Miralax with a healthcare provider is a smart move. Understanding the full scope of what you’re taking, including potential interactions with medications, can help you mitigate risks and stay healthy.
